H.Con.Res. 330 (100th)

A concurrent resolution providing that the United States should not undertake negotiations to compensate Iran in connection with the shooting down of Iran Air Flight 655 until the Government of Iran undertakes negotiations to compensate for attacks by Iranian military forces on civilian shipping and United States Armed Forces in the Persian Gulf.

Summary

States that the United States should not negotiate compensation or reparation payments to Iran or any party in Iran in connection with the shooting down of Iran Air Flight 655 unless and until the Government of Iran negotiates compensation or reparation payments for attacks by Iranian military forces on civilian shipping and U.S. armed forces in the Persian Gulf.
